Abstract: In the present paper, we will discuss the Hankel determinants H(f)=a2a4a32 of order 2 for normalized concave functions f(z)=z+a2z2+a3z3+dots with a pole at pin(0,1). Here, a meromorphic function is called concave if it maps the unit disk conformally onto a domain whose complement is convex. To this end, we will characterize the coefficient body of order 2 for the class of analytic functions varphi(z) on |z|<1 with |varphi|<1 and varphi(p)=p. We believe that this is helpful for other extremal problems concerning a2,a3,a4 for normalized concave functions with a pole at p.
